Hermès Presents Chaîne d’Ancre Punk Exhibition

Copyright: Jack Davison

Since its creation in 1983, the Chaîne d’Ancre jewelry line has constantly evolved to become a Hermès classic. Today, the Creative Director of Hermès jewelry Pierre Hardy reinvents the collection and renders it more provocative than ever. It reaches the punk territories with its creations that feature a safety pin – which is the ultimate symbol of the rebellious youth in the 1970s.

The pieces, made of gold or silver, are showcased in a set that takes over the Hermès store at 24 Faubourg Saint-Honoré – shattering walls to reveal the gold creations and witnessing totem-like standing blocks to present the silver ones. This expressive setting will be available for viewing from June 20th until July 29th from 10:30 AM to 6:30 PM.
